Origin Agritech Limited (NASDAQ:SEED – Get Free Report) saw a significant decrease in short interest in July. As of July 31st, there was short interest totaling 27,205 shares, a decrease of 48.5% from the July 15th total of 52,840 shares. Currently, 0.2% of the shares of the company are sold short. Based on an average trading volume of 4,705 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 5.8 days.

Origin Agritech Company Profile
Origin Agritech (NASDAQ:SEED) is an agricultural biotechnology company focused on the research, development, production and sale of hybrid rice seeds. The company’s core business activities center on the application of molecular marker‐assisted selection and genomics to develop high‐yielding, disease‐resistant and stress‐tolerant rice varieties. Its product portfolio includes proprietary cytoplasmic male sterile (CMS) lines, hybrid parent lines and commercial seed varieties tailored to the agronomic needs of rice growers.
Origin Agritech primarily serves the major rice‐producing provinces of China, where it has established breeding stations, seed production bases and a distribution network to supply certified hybrid seeds.
